Anna Edith Sinclair was born on 17 May 1876 in Adair County, Iowa, and died on 7 June 1949 in Humboldt County, California. She married William LeRoy Dunston on 21 February 1901. 

She is the last family leader profiled from my book, “Landscape of Valor: The Sinclair Legacy.”


Anna and William settled in Grey Eagle, Todd County, Minnesota. They had eight sons, but sadly, one of them died shortly after his birth.


One of those sons was my husband’s grandfather, Teddy Dunston.


Anna and William, both music and reading enthusiasts, shared their passion with their sons, who in turn passed it on to their own children. My husband, their great-grandson, is an avid reader and enjoys listening to music whenever he gets the chance. 


The Great Depression ended their farming and dairy business, so they moved to California to start over. Anna suffered a stroke, and William passed away. Their sons cared for their mother until LeRoy's passing. 


Anna’s family still talks of her with reverence and love.
